20 Menahem raised the money by making all the rich and powerful men pay taxes. He taxed each man 20 ounces[a] of silver and gave the money to the king of Assyria. So the king of Assyria left and did not stay there in Israel.

21 All the great things that Menahem did are written in the book, The History of the Kings of Israel. 22 Menahem died and was buried with his ancestors. His son Pekahiah became the new king after him.
